The Nunda Herald
Nunda, Illinois
(McHenry County)
Thursday, June 19, 1902

Mrs. Mehitable Colby

McHenry Plaindealer: Another of the early settlers of McHenry county has passed away. Mrs. Mehitable E. Colby, who has lived in this county since 1840, died Saturday, June 7, 1902. She was born March 26, 1828. Was a member of one of the leading families of the community, that of Abijah and Thankful Smith. Only three of her eleven brothers and sisters surviver her, viz: Mrs. Abigail Colby, Crystal Lake; Mrs. Almira Brown, McHenry, and Mrs. Harriett Snyder, Hartford, Conn. These were all present at the funeral.

In 1834 she was united in maarriage to Page Colby, who now in old age is left to mourn the loss of a faithful and loving companion. Of her six children four now remain. Mrs. Ida I. Stevens and Mrs. Ellen A. Gage had preceded her to the life beyond. Those remaining are Chas. C. Colby, Mary J. Ford, George W. Colby and Willard E. Colby.

Mrs. Colby lived a retired and quiet life, but made her presence felt for good, nor only in her own family, but in her unselfish manner blessed many who incidentally came in contact with her life. In her home her kindness, love and devotion to the family were very manifest until the last, and only a few hours before the end came she expressed her sympathy for her husband and comforted him with the assurance that "the separation would only be for a short time." How true it is, although years it may be may pass, they are but short. To some in contact with such a choice spirit as this is to be made better by its association.

The funeral was conducted from the house, Monday, June 9, 1902, by Rev. W. B. Lauck of the M. E. church in the presence of a large company of relatives and friends, and her remains were laid to rest in the McHenry cemetery.
